Message type: E = Error
Message class: FMCE - Cover Eligibility Messages
Message number: 305
Message text: Other budget address not allowed by budget structure
The <DS:SIMG.FMBCS_FMCERG>derivation strategy for generating cover
groups</> has derived another budget address &V1&&V2& in the same cover
group. This budget address, however, is not allowed by the existing
budget structure.
The cover group cannot be created for the following combination of
<DS:DE.BUKU_BUDCAT>budget category</>, fiscal year, and budget address:
&V3&&V4&
Check the derivation strategy for the generation of cover groups in
Customizing or verify the definition of budget addresses in the budget
structure.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

- Other budget address not allowed by budget structure ?The SAP error message FMCE305 ("Other budget address not allowed by budget structure") typically occurs in the context of budget management within the SAP system, particularly when working with Funds Management (FM). This error indicates that the budget address you are trying to use is not permitted according to the defined budget structure.
Cause:
- Incorrect Budget Structure: The budget structure defined in the system does not allow the use of the specified budget address. This could be due to configuration settings that restrict certain budget addresses based on the type of transaction or the budget category.
- Missing Authorization: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access or use the specified budget address.
- Incorrect Document Type: The document type being used may not be compatible with the budget address.
- Configuration Issues: There may be issues in the configuration of the Funds Management module, such as incorrect settings in the budget structure or budget categories.
Solution:
Check Budget Structure Configuration:
- Review the configuration of the budget structure in the SAP system. Ensure that the budget address you are trying to use is included in the budget structure.
- Navigate to the configuration settings for Funds Management and verify the settings for budget categories and addresses.
Verify Document Type:
- Ensure that the document type you are using is compatible with the budget address. If necessary, change the document type to one that is allowed.
User Authorizations:
- Check the user authorizations to ensure that the user has the necessary permissions to access the budget address. This may involve reviewing roles and authorizations in the SAP system.
Consult with Configuration Team:
- If you are not able to resolve the issue, consult with your SAP configuration team or a functional consultant who specializes in Funds Management. They can help identify any configuration issues that may be causing the error.
Testing:
- After making any changes, perform tests to ensure that the error no longer occurs and that the budget address can be used as intended.
